Tanzania Vice President signals continuity, draws on predecessor’s experience


By Our Reporter, Dodoma

The new Vice President, Ambassador Dr. Emmanuel Nchimbi, has pledged to continue providing close support to President Samia Suluhu Hassan, emphasizing administrative continuity while leveraging the expertise of former Vice President Dr. Philip Mpango.

Speaking at a formal handover ceremony at Chamwino State House, Dr. Nchimbi highlighted the groundwork completed during the first phase of the sixth-term government, describing it as crucial for ensuring smooth preparations for the 2025 general elections and effective policy coordination. 

The remarks signal an intent to maintain stability within the executive branch while aligning government operations with the Chama Cha Mapinduzi (CCM) manifesto.

“The achievements of the first phase created efficiencies that strengthened governance operations,” Dr. Nchimbi said, stressing his commitment to provide strategic advice to the President and facilitate the implementation of development-focused policies. 

He underscored the role of the Vice President’s Office as a central hub for policy execution, particularly in sectors such as the blue economy and socio-economic development.


Dr. Nchimbi also recognized the continued advisory value of former Vice President Mpango, whose experience in macroeconomic management and policy oversight is seen as instrumental in bridging institutional memory with new leadership approaches. 

“We welcome his guidance where needed,” he said, signaling a pragmatic approach to governance that combines continuity with fresh leadership.

Former Vice President Mpango congratulated Dr. Nchimbi and urged him to exercise wisdom and humility in executing his duties, noting that the Vice President’s Office functions as both a principal advisory body and a bridge between the presidency and citizens.

By publicly affirming both continuity and collaboration with his predecessor, Dr. Nchimbi positions himself as a stabilizing figure within the executive, enhancing public confidence in the administration’s capacity to implement policies effectively.


The handover also underscores the CCM’s focus on seamless leadership transitions and institutional resilience, key factors in sustaining governance credibility and advancing development initiatives across the country.
